    great to have you on the forum, and feel free to ask when you run into troubles, we are here to help! and just to clear up some things im certain will come up later, your best bet in whatever project you take on is to pick up a master replicas saber off ebay that has a busted blade and gut it for the electronics which will run every type of led we use with the exception of the 5w and is currently the best thing going until erv's buttered toast is available...

    once again welcome and good luck, most of all dont be afraid to get in there and throw solder like there's no tomorrow, the best way to learn is simply to try
